Let’s start with what is Commercial Pilot License – A Commercial Pilot Licence is a type of pilot license that permits the holder to act as a pilot of an aircraft and be paid for their work. Different licenses are issued for the major aircraft categories: airplanes, airships, balloons, gliders, gyroplanes, and helicopters.

Commercial Pilot License Eligibility Criteria

  • The minimum age limit for CPL is 17 years, and the maximum age limit is 60 to 65 years.
  • A candidate should have passed or appeared in class 12 with physics, chemistry, and mathematics as the main subjects.
  • A candidate should have scored a minimum aggregate of 50% passing percentage to get admission to CPL.
  • The student needs to pass 2 medical tests to become eligible for CPL, as per DGCA requirements.
